Key Decisions
Database Collection
Existing batch coordinators to provide alumni details (batch, roll number, name, contact, email ID, designation, present location) via Google Forms by Friday, September 5, 2025, with the process to be completed within 15 days, including elections.
Election Process
Two-phase approach: Database compilation followed by unique ID assignment and online voting (Google Forms or better tool); confirmation emails for audit trail; uniform elections for all batches, no nominations.
Constitution Formulation
Elected coordinators to represent batches in creating the constitution, incorporating expert input.
Technical Tools
Explore third-party software like WAVE; default to Google Forms if needed; seek technical ideas post-minutes publication.
Term Length
3 years as per roadmap, subject to further deliberation by coordinators' committee.
Scope
Elections for the new "JKSS Alumni Foundation" after trust dissolution.
Spokesperson
CA Ovais Shah appointed as official spokesperson for the Election Commission.
